Abstract:e23075 Background: Innovation in health care delivery is needed to improve care for cancer survivors. We report a pragmatic study intended to evaluate our experience with adopting screening guidelines from the National Comprehensive Cancer Network (NCCN) to the routine care of breast cancer survivors in primary care and oncology follow up.
